Home | History | Annotate | Download | only in cintltst

Lines Matching refs:sortkey

44 static char* U_EXPORT2 ucol_sortKeyToString(const UCollator *coll, const uint8_t *sortkey, char *buffer, uint32_t len) {
50 while ((b = *sortkey++) != 0) {
1074 log_verbose("testing SortKey begins...\n");
1123 doAssert( (sortklen == osortklen), "Sortkey length should be the same (abcda, abcda)");
1169 log_verbose("getting sortkey for an empty string\n");
1175 log_err("Empty string generated wrong sortkey!\n");
1182 log_err("Invalid string didn't return sortkey size of 0\n");
1186 log_verbose("testing sortkey ends...\n");
1508 uint8_t sortkey[512], lower[512], upper[512];
1639 skSize = ucol_getSortKey(coll, buffer, buffSize, sortkey, 512);
1640 lowerSize = ucol_getBound(sortkey, skSize, UCOL_BOUND_LOWER, 1, lower, 512, &status);
1641 upperSize = ucol_getBound(sortkey, skSize, UCOL_BOUND_UPPER_LONG, 1, upper, 512, &status);
1644 skSize = ucol_getSortKey(coll, buffer, buffSize, sortkey, 512);
1645 if(strcmp((const char *)lower, (const char *)sortkey) > 0) {
1648 if(strcmp((const char *)upper, (const char *)sortkey) <= 0) {
1662 uint8_t sortKey[256];
1669 memset(sortKey, filler, 256);
1670 skLen2 = ucol_getSortKey(coll, uString, strLen, sortKey, i);
1672 log_err("For buffer size %i, got different sortkey length. Expected %i got %i\n", i, skLen, skLen2);
1675 if(sortKey[j] != filler) {
1954 log_err("Wrong preflight size for merged sortkey\n");
1969 log_err("Empty sortkey didn't produce a level separator\n");